Worship and Study is a welcoming, participatory congregation with a deep commitment to Jewish pluralism, egalitarianism, and freedom of inquiry.
Shabbat services include: spirited, musical davening (prayer) grounded in traditional liturgy; a lively, wide-ranging Torah discussion; and a convivial Kiddush. We rely on our members to lead us in prayer and teach us Torah, and we are always seeking new voices to uncover new facets of our tradition.
